Towards Correct Cloud Resource Allocation in Business Processes

Cloud environments are being increasingly used for deploying and executing business processes to provide a high level of performance with low operating cost. Nevertheless, due to the lack of an explicit and formal description of the resource perspective in the existing business processes, the correc...

Full description

Saved in:
Bibliographic Details
Published inIEEE transactions on services computing Vol. 10; no. 1; pp. 23 - 36
Main Authors Graiet, Mohamed, Mammar, Amel, Boubaker, Souha, Gaaloul, Walid
Format Journal Article
LanguageEnglish
Published IEEE 01.01.2017
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:Cloud environments are being increasingly used for deploying and executing business processes to provide a high level of performance with low operating cost. Nevertheless, due to the lack of an explicit and formal description of the resource perspective in the existing business processes, the correctness of Cloud resources management can not be verified. The aim of the present work is to offer a formal definition of the resource perspective in business processes as a step towards ensuring a correct and consistent Cloud resource allocation in business process modeling. Concretely, we propose a formalism based on the Event-B language for specifying Cloud resource allocation policies in business process models. This formal specification is used to formally validate the consistency of Cloud resource allocation for process modeling at design time, and to analyze and check its correctness according to user requirements and resource capabilities. In order to show its feasibility, our approach has been tested using a real use case study from an industrial partner.
ISSN:1939-1374
1939-1374
2372-0204
DOI:10.1109/TSC.2016.2594062